Zoom, one of the most popular video conferencing platforms, allows users to customize their virtual backgrounds to liven up their video call. Here are the top 10 cultural diversity Zoom backgrounds to impress your virtual audience.

1. Cherry Blossoms in Tokyo

Transport your audience to the bustling streets of Tokyo with the stunning cherry blossoms. Known as “Sakura” in Japan, the cherry blossom season signifies renewal and the beauty of life. It is a great background to bring a touch of Asian culture to your virtual meeting.

2. The Great Pyramids of Giza

Take your virtual meeting on a tour of the ancient Egyptian Pyramids that have stood for over 4,000 years. This background provides a perfect backdrop for history enthusiasts and anyone interested in ancient world cultures.

3. Santorini Blue Domes

Bring a touch of the Aegean coast to your virtual meeting with the Santorini blue dome zoom background. The striking backdrop will impress your virtual audience with the iconic Greek Island architecture and stunning views of the Mediterranean Sea.

4. New York City Skyline

The Big Apple’s skyline screams diversity as it stands as a melting pot of cultures from all around the world. The Empire State Building and the Statue of Liberty are great features to show off and add that American touch to your virtual background.

5. The Taj Mahal

The Taj Mahal, located in the Northern region of India, is a world-renowned symbol of love and architectural beauty. Add a touch of cultural diversity to your Zoom calls with the breathtaking Taj Mahal as your background.

6. Dutch Windmills

The iconic Dutch windmills provide a beautiful and calming background for your virtual meeting. The Netherlands is home to some of the world’s most innovative and creative thinkers and is a great way to show off a European touch to your call.

7. The Great Wall of China

Stretching over 13,000 miles, the Great Wall of China is a bucket list adventure for many people. Impress your virtual audience with one of the new seven wonders of the world and show off your admiration for the East Asian culture.

8. Sydney Harbour Bridge

A stunningly dramatic shot from Sydney Harbour Bridge is the perfect virtual meeting backdrop. It provides a beautiful view and adds a touch of class to your call. This background is excellent for anyone looking to add Australian culture to their video meetings.

9. Masai Mara Migration

The iconic Masai Mara Migration is a world-renowned cultural tour that provides a firsthand look at how the Masai Mara people live. Featuring wildebeest migration, your audience will take a fascinating journey through one of the oldest cultures in Africa.

10. Machu Picchu

Machu Picchu, one of the world’s most famous landmarks, is a sure way to dazzle your virtual audience with history, culture, and stunning visuals. Impress your audience and let them take a journey to Peru with this beautiful background.
